The Best keyword research tool is determined in part by the purpose for which it will be used. Are you mostly utilizing paid or unpaid marketing techniques? For example, if you use Google AdWords as part of your marketing strategy, you'll undoubtedly use a variety of Google tools to build up your campaigns.
The Google Best Keyword Research Tool, Traffic Estimator, Adplanner, and Google Editor are all included. There are a number of other tools that should be used to discover the search and competition data of the term if you are utilizing SEO or other unpaid techniques to generate your keywords.
Regardless of whether you use paid or unpaid traffic strategies, the Google Keyword tool is a wonderful place to start. It offers a large, completely free list of terms with high global search volume (the key metric to start with). You want to develop keywords from this list that sufficiently target your niche while also offering low competition for your chosen strategy.
For non-paid techniques like SEO, you should look at the top ten Google listings for each phrase to see who your competitors are. Will you be able to rank in the top ten results for the keyword you've chosen? This is the question you must answer before deciding on a keyword to concentrate on.
Traffic Travis is one of the top keyword research tools for SEO strategies. It comes with a great free version that quickly assesses the difficulty of ranking for a specific keyword. This is one of a new breed of tools, such as Market Samurai and Term Elite, that provide a comprehensive examination of potential competition sites for your chosen keyword.
These tools focus on backlinks, public relations, and on-page SEO to offer you a thorough picture of your chances of ranking on the first page. Apart from being free, Traffic Travis takes care of the majority of the grunt work involved in evaluating PR, searches, and backlinks. It just informs you whether the search term is easy or difficult to rank for in the SEO module. As a result, it is a clear victor in terms of usability.
